Output d2dc4e0d3ab7898e41f77f8523276121b36b74ebf99fbbd850634be3a19e9395:85

value
282490000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f7bf21f143b01c0457a3dc02a17bc050db4c342 OP_EQUALVERIFY OP_CHECKSIG
address
1JTUYYYWSPsDqSqExvUNKW4Mffwj68ibpm
transaction
d2dc4e0d3ab7898e41f77f8523276121b36b74ebf99fbbd850634be3a19e9395
spent
true